Kermit Baker is a seasoned urban studies and planning expert with a Ph.D. from MIT, an MCP from Harvard University, and a BA from The Johns Hopkins University. He has 29 years of experience as the Chief Economist at the American Institute of Architects (AIA), leveraging his skills in strategic planning, marketing strategy, research, and policy analysis to drive sustainability and green building initiatives.
